如何编写一份完美的测试报告书?7个关键要素助你一臂之力

测试报告书的重要性及核心价值

测试报告书是软件开发过程中不可或缺的重要文档,它直接反映了产品的质量状况和测试工作的成效。一份优秀的测试报告书不仅能够清晰地呈现测试结果,还能为后续的产品改进和项目决策提供有力支持。本文将深入探讨如何编写一份完美的测试报告书,助你掌握这一关键技能。

 

测试报告书的基本结构

一份完整的测试报告书通常包含以下几个主要部分:

1. 封面:包含项目名称、测试类型、报告日期等基本信息。

2. 目录:便于读者快速定位所需内容。

3. 测试概述:简要介绍测试背景、目标和范围。

4. 测试环境:详细描述测试所用的硬件、软件环境。

5. 测试过程:说明测试方法、用例设计和执行情况。

6. 测试结果:呈现测试数据、发现的缺陷和问题。

7. 结论与建议:总结测试结果,提出改进建议。

8. 附录:包含详细的测试用例、缺陷报告等支持性文档。

 

编写测试报告书的7个关键要素

1. 明确目标受众:在开始编写之前,要先确定报告的主要读者。是项目经理、开发团队还是客户?不同的受众群体对信息的需求和关注点不同,这将影响报告的内容组织和详细程度。

2. 结构清晰:采用逻辑清晰的结构,使用标题、子标题和段落分隔符来组织内容。这不仅能提高报告的可读性,还能帮助读者快速定位所需信息。在这方面,ONES研发管理平台提供了强大的文档协作功能,可以轻松创建和管理结构化的测试报告。

3. 数据可视化:使用图表、图形和表格来呈现测试数据和结果。直观的数据展示方式能够帮助读者更快地理解和分析信息。例如,可以使用饼图展示不同类型缺陷的分布,或者用折线图显示缺陷修复的趋势。

4. 客观准确:报告中的所有信息都应该基于事实和数据,避免主观臆测。准确描述测试过程、环境和结果,不夸大成绩,也不掩盖问题。如果存在不确定性,应明确指出并解释原因。

5. 问题分析:不仅要列出发现的缺陷和问题,还要深入分析其原因和潜在影响。这有助于开发团队更好地理解问题的本质,从而制定有效的解决方案。在进行问题分析时,可以考虑使用ONES研发管理平台的知识库功能,记录和共享分析结果,促进团队协作和知识积累。

6. 优先级排序:对发现的问题进行优先级排序,帮助开发团队和项目管理者确定修复顺序。可以根据问题的严重程度、影响范围和修复难度等因素来评估优先级。ONES平台提供了灵活的任务管理功能,可以轻松地为每个问题分配优先级并进行跟踪。

7. 改进建议:基于测试结果和问题分析,提出具体的改进建议。这些建议应该是可操作的,并且与项目目标相一致。例如,可以建议优化特定模块的性能、加强某些功能的测试覆盖率,或者调整开发流程以减少某类缺陷的出现。

 

测试报告书的编写技巧

1. 使用简洁明了的语言:避免使用过于技术性或晦涩难懂的术语。如果必须使用专业术语,请提供简短的解释或在附录中添加术语表。

2. 保持一致性:在整个报告中使用一致的术语、格式和风格。这有助于提高报告的专业性和可读性。

3. 突出重点:将最重要的信息放在每个部分的开头,使用醒目的标题或摘要来吸引读者注意。

4. 提供上下文:在描述问题或测试结果时,提供足够的背景信息,以便读者理解其重要性和影响。

5. 使用模板:开发和使用标准化的测试报告模板,可以提高编写效率并确保报告的完整性。ONES研发管理平台提供了可定制的文档模板功能,可以根据团队需求创建和管理测试报告模板。

 

测试报告书的审核与优化

在完成测试报告书的初稿后,进行审核和优化是确保报告质量的关键步骤:

1. 同行评审:邀请团队成员或其他测试人员审阅报告,获取反馈和建议。

2. 校对与修订:仔细检查报告中的拼写、语法错误和数据准确性。

3. 可读性测试:请非技术背景的人员阅读报告,评估其清晰度和易理解程度。

4. 版本控制:使用版本控制系统管理报告的不同版本,确保团队成员能够访问最新的报告内容。ONES平台的版本控制功能可以有效地管理文档的变更历史,便于追踪修订和协作。

5. 持续改进:根据项目反馈和实际应用情况,不断优化报告的结构和内容,建立最佳实践。

 

测试报告书

 

结语

编写一份完美的测试报告书是一项需要不断练习和改进的技能。通过掌握本文介绍的7个关键要素和编写技巧,你将能够创建出清晰、准确、有价值的测试报告书。记住,一份优秀的测试报告书不仅是对测试工作的总结,更是推动产品质量提升的重要工具。随着经验的积累和工具的合理使用,你的测试报告书将成为项目成功的关键助力。